Burnham’s Pub Rate Cut Faces Offset From Gambling Tax Plans

UK Prime Minister Andy Burnham has reduced business rates for pubs, social clubs and live music venues by 20% during his first week in office. The new gambling tax proposal may limit the financial benefit for licensed premises.

Business Rate Reduction for Venues

The rate cut applies to hospitality and entertainment locations across the United Kingdom. The measure was introduced as part of the government’s initial economic support package. Licensed establishments will see a direct decrease in annual property tax obligations starting with the current fiscal period.

Gambling Tax Impact on Pub Revenue

The administration is simultaneously advancing a revised gambling tax framework. Pubs and social clubs generate a portion of their income from gaming machines and betting terminals. Higher levies on gambling operators could reduce profit margins for venues that rely on machine earnings. Industry analysis from iGaming Expert indicates that the combined effect of the rate cut and the tax adjustment requires careful financial planning for pub operators. The government has not yet published the final tax rates for the upcoming fiscal period.
